Output 99929b1488393668cc6d00c7f16379e19ba12418986d1202619aee0ec76acce6:1

value
15664106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8cb6727144a4ddf82f1bbb0d6b39257b4b287e OP_EQUAL
address
3CrzvqRf7C6Dn1RX8RhWxVW8gmAus9uFqC
transaction
99929b1488393668cc6d00c7f16379e19ba12418986d1202619aee0ec76acce6
spent
true